2008-05-05 Sebastian Dröge <slomo@circular-chaos.org>
+ Patch by: Young-Ho Cha <ganadist at chollian dot net>
+
+ * gst/subparse/samiparse.c: (handle_start_sync),
+ (start_sami_element), (end_sami_element), (characters_sami),
+ (sami_context_reset):
+ Only output characters inside the "sync" elements. There could be
+ other elements like "style" that have some content but should
+ not be printed. Fixes bug #467911.

+ /* FIXME: this is not correct. According to[0] the start parameter
+ * specifies the time when the text should be shown and not the time
+ * when the text should be hidden again.
+ * This essentially means that we have to look at the next sync element
+ * before pushing one buffer and push the last buffer with -1
+ * as duration after the body element is closed.
+ * [0] http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/ms971327.aspx
+ */
